One major trend in maintenance practices is the adoption of predictive maintenance techniques. By utilizing sensors and data analytics, organizations can now predict when a piece of equipment is likely to fail before it actually does. This allows for scheduled maintenance to be performed at the optimal time, reducing downtime and minimizing the risk of unexpected breakdowns.
Another trend in maintenance practices is the use of condition-based monitoring. Rather than relying on a fixed schedule for maintenance tasks, condition-based monitoring involves continuously monitoring the performance of equipment and making maintenance decisions based on its current condition. This approach can help organizations identify potential issues early on and take corrective action before they escalate into major problems.
Proactive maintenance practices also involve a shift towards a more holistic approach to maintenance management. This includes the integration of maintenance data with other business systems, such as enterprise resource planning (ERP) software, to provide a comprehensive view of asset performance and maintenance needs. By breaking down silos between maintenance and other departments, organizations can improve communication, collaboration, and decision-making processes.
Furthermore, the future of maintenance is also likely to see an increase in the use of technologies such as artificial intelligence (AI) and machine learning. These technologies can analyze vast amounts of data to identify patterns and trends, enabling organizations to make more informed decisions and optimize maintenance strategies. AI-powered predictive maintenance solutions, for example, can help organizations prioritize maintenance tasks, improve asset performance, and reduce costs.
